Outline of Final Research Achievements

Streptococcus mutans is the primary etiological agent of human dental caries, and forms biofilm on the tooth surface. Many genes associate with biofilm formation of S. mutans.
In this study, gene expressions of SMU832 and SMU833 might associate with aggregation and regulation of biofilm development in early exponential phase. The biofilm formation of the SMU832 and 833-deficient mutants in Tryptic Soy Broth without Dextrose containing glucose was dependent on extracellular DNA.
